Synergy Network Is Building a Security-First Layer-1 Ecosystem

Synergy Network is developing a next-generation Layer-1 blockchain ecosystem focused on security, interoperability, digital identity, smart-contract execution and simplified Web3 usability.

Rather than treating wallets, bridges, security, identity and applications as separate products, the project is building them as interconnected components of one network.

A Full Technology Stack

The network's architecture includes:

  • Proof of Synergy (PoSy) for consensus
  • ETDAG for transaction ordering and network architecture
  • Aegis Post-Quantum Security
  • Universal Meta-Address (UMA) technology
  • SynQ smart-contract tooling
  • AIVM execution architecture
  • Relay Protocol for cross-network interoperability
  • Atlas for network indexing and exploration

Security is designed into multiple layers of the ecosystem, including transaction verification, application execution, user permissions and network-level protection.

Aegis also reflects the project's focus on integrating post-quantum security into its architecture rather than treating quantum resistance only as a future add-on.

Rethinking Cross-Chain Interaction

The network's Relay Protocol is being developed to make cross-network interaction easier while reducing the need for users to manually deal with different chains, addresses, token standards and conventional bridge infrastructure.

Relay Protocol is currently identified as being in Phase 2 Testnet, meaning development and testing are still ongoing.

Unified Digital Identity

Synergy's Universal Meta-Address technology follows the same usability philosophy by aiming to provide users with a more unified digital identity across supported applications and networks.

Users are also intended to retain control over what information and permissions applications can access.

Developers Get Their Own Infrastructure

Synergy Forge serves as the network's developer environment, bringing together technical documentation, SynQ tooling, ForgeIDE, testing resources, RPC integration, wallet integration and network architecture documentation.

Within Testnet v3, developers can use the SynQ toolchain to compile supported contracts locally and generate deterministic source, bytecode, ABI, manifest and storage-schema hashes.

Its documentation also clearly separates functionality that is already verifiable from functionality still being developed.

For example, it does not currently present the complete general-purpose SynQ-to-AIVM on-chain deployment path as fully operational simply because local contract artifacts can already be generated.

The intended technical flow combines SynQ, Aegis admission, AIVM execution, consensus finality and Atlas indexing.

SNRG Has Defined Network Utility

SNRG is Synergy Network's native utility token.

According to official Synergy Network material, its intended network uses include:

  • network and execution fees;
  • staking and network operation;
  • validator participation;
  • ecosystem services;
  • governance participation where applicable; and
  • incentives for contributors, node operators and verified developers.

This gives SNRG functional roles within the ecosystem without relying on token-price predictions or promises of financial returns.
